Modeling the solvent extraction of oilseeds
Authors:G Abraham  R J Hron Sr  S P Koltun
Affiliation:(1) Southern Regional Research Center, ARS/USDA, P.O.Box 19687, 70179 New Orleans, LA
Abstract:A computer model and an experimental procedure for generating data needed in the model have been developed for the oilseed extraction process. The experiments are relatively simple and are performed with a bench-top extractor. Experimental results and modeling calculations are presented for the extraction of cottonseed using hexane, isopropanol and ethanol. The calculations show that in an alcohol extraction using a chill separation, isopropanol’s greater oil miscibility allows for a lower solvent-to-feed ratio than does ethanol. Using the latter solvent, however, achieves lower residual lipids in the extracted meal because recycled ethanol contains less oil than recycled isopropanol.
